Immigration and Checkpoints Authority (ICA) officers cut open the floorboard of a Malaysia-registered car during an enhanced check at Woodlands Checkpoint on Aug 4.
In photographs posted on its Facebook on Tuesday (Aug 11), the multi-purpose vehicle’s (MPV) floorboard was seen cut open from its underneath, revealing cartons of cigarettes.
Several cartons of duty-unpaid cigarettes were similarly found under the MPV’s bonnet.Â
ICA said its officers had directed the vehicle for enhanced checks, acting on information received from its Integrated Targeting Centre.
There, search and examination officers found more than 600 cartons and over 900 packets of duty-unpaid cigarettes concealed in the floorboard of the vehicle.
